I have been using this program (0.224) for a while to convert mkv files to mp4 and it has generally worked well. However the mp4 file will often have the audio out of sync by about 2.4 seconds. I can correct this by adding "2400" in the "Delay" setting. However lately I have had several mkv files that result in MP4Box crashing at 99%. The error in the log is "Mp4Box terminated with error: 3221226356"
This is the source file information (from Mediainfo)
I pretty much have the default settings for MkvToMp4. The only thing I think I have changed is the output format (changed from m4v to mp4). This is the log output:Code:eneral Unique ID : 102114455389470586777438309571762730193 (0x4CD2875B6F5D19211A555D703D5634D1) Complete name : K:\VIDEO\Race.mkv Format : Matroska Format version : Version 4 / Version 2 File size : 1.19 GiB Duration : 1h 5mn Overall bit rate : 2 599 Kbps Writing application : Lavf56.25.101 Writing library : Lavf56.25.101 / Lavf56.25.101 Video ID : 1 Format : AVC Format/Info : Advanced Video Codec Format profile : Main@L3.1 Format settings, CABAC : Yes Format settings, ReFrames : 2 frames Codec ID : V_MPEG4/ISO/AVC Duration : 1h 5mn Bit rate mode : Constant Nominal bit rate : 2 500 Kbps Width : 1 280 pixels Height : 720 pixels Display aspect ratio : 16:9 Frame rate mode : Constant Frame rate : 25.000 fps Color space : YUV Chroma subsampling : 4:2:0 Bit depth : 8 bits Scan type : Progressive Bits/(Pixel*Frame) : 0.109 Default : No Forced : No Audio ID : 2 Format : AAC Format/Info : Advanced Audio Codec Format profile : LC Codec ID : A_AAC Duration : 1h 5mn Channel(s) : 2 channels Channel positions : Front: L R Sampling rate : 44.1 KHz Frame rate : 43.066 fps (1024 spf) Compression mode : Lossy Language : English Default : Yes Forced : No Menu 00:00:00.000 : :Chapter 1 00:04:57.640 : :Chapter 2 00:50:26.480 : :Chapter 3
Code:Repack/encoder video to MP4 for Apple iPhone, iPad, ATV2. MkvToMp4 version 0.224 (x64) Build from: Sep 24 2013 14:57:05 Use log file: ../Temp/Logs\10_07_2016_16_58_57.txt CoreAudioToolbox version: 7.9.7.9 Added on list: K:/VIDEO/Race.mkv Started processing file: K:/VIDEO/Race.mkv Starting MkvExtract with the parameters: ../Tools/mkvextract\mkvextract tracks "K:/VIDEO/Race.mkv" 0:"../Temp/video.264" 1:"../Temp/Race_internal_audio_2.AAC" Extracting track 0 with the CodecID 'V_MPEG4/ISO/AVC' to the file '../Temp/video.264'. Container format: AVC/h.264 elementary stream Extracting track 1 with the CodecID 'A_AAC' to the file '../Temp/Race_internal_audio_2.AAC'. Container format: raw AAC file with ADTS headers Starting Eac3To with the parameters: ..\Tools\eac3to\eac3to "C:\Users\shane\Desktop\MKV 2 MP4\MkvToMp4_0.224\Temp\Race_internal_audio_2.AAC" "..\Temp\Race_internal_audio_2_new.AAC" +2400ms -progressnumbers AAC, 2.0 channels, 44.1kHz Applying AAC delay... A remaining delay of +9ms could not be fixed. Creating file "..\Temp\Race_internal_audio_2_new.AAC"... Done. Starting Mp4Box with the parameters: ../Tools/mp4box/x64/MP4Box.exe -new -add "../Temp/video.264":fps=25.000:lang=eng:name="" -add "C:/Users/shane/Desktop/MKV 2 MP4/MkvToMp4_0.224/Temp/Race_internal_audio_2_new.AAC"#1:fps=25.000:lang=eng:name="" -itags tool="MkvToMp4 [www.mkvtomp4.ru] version 0.224 (x64)" "K:/VIDEO/test\Race.mp4" -tmp "../Temp/Mp4Box" AVC-H264 import - frame size 1280 x 720 at 25.000 FPS Mp4Box terminated with error: 3221226356 Total time: 41 sec. 0 files processed. 1 errors.
Is there anything obvious here? Thanks.
+ Reply to Thread
Results 1 to 2 of 2
-
-
The mp4box version included with 0.224 MkvToMp4 is 0.5.1-DEV-rev4765. I updated the files to the current version of mp4box which is 0.6.1-rev0=g72d766c-master and I still had the same error. When I used the command line with either of these, mp4box crashes at 99% when importing the video file, so the AAC file isn't hte problem.
I had an old program called YAMB that also uses MP4Box and the version was 0.4.6-DEV (build 1). I took the .264 and .AAC files created in the TEMP directory by MkvToMp4 and used the command line for the older MP4Box and it works and creates and mp4 file. It does generate several:
"WARNING: NAL Unit type 13 not handled - adding"
The video plays fine with no audio sync issues, but playback is very choppy.Last edited by lemmy999; 10th Jul 2016 at 17:16.
Similar Threads
-
Problem in MkvToMp4
By Echonine in forum Video ConversionReplies: 7Last Post: 17th Feb 2016, 10:08 -
Help with MKVtoMP4 Audio synch
By MAXIMUS01CAN in forum Video ConversionReplies: 2Last Post: 13th Jan 2014, 02:46 -
mkvtomp4 error
By eatatwhiteys in forum Newbie / General discussionsReplies: 1Last Post: 16th Sep 2013, 10:36 -
audio sync problem - progressively out of sync during playback - MPEG 2
By TheShortStraw in forum Newbie / General discussionsReplies: 4Last Post: 20th May 2013, 07:36 -
audio sync problem, how to work out progressive audio sync delay
By jolt321 in forum Newbie / General discussionsReplies: 13Last Post: 10th Apr 2012, 21:09